  • Description
  • Geographical origins: China, Japan.
    Adult dimensions: Height up to 30 m, width up to 10 m.
    Foliage: Evergreen.
    Type of soil: Light and well drained. Does not like chalk.
    Hardiness: Hardy to -25°C.
    Exposure: Full light.


    Properties and uses:
    The Chinese white pine is a rare tree that is often grown by collectors or bonsai lovers. Its brown trunk turns greyish scarlet and becomes deeply cracked over time. Its pale green needles are slender and long (up to 16cm). This pine will really profit in a large garden where it is a lone specimen. It is equally magnificent when grown as a bonsai.
